What drives the cost of a Albuquerque long-distance move

  • Distance from Albuquerque to your destination
  • Home size and total inventory weight or cubic feet
  • Stairs, elevators, COIs, long carries, and shuttle requirements
  • Packing services, specialty items, and vehicle transport
  • Storage-in-transit if closing dates don't line up
  • Time of year — summer, month-end, and holiday peaks run highest

Why quotes differ

Why Quotes Can Differ

Two estimates on the same move can come in hundreds of dollars apart. Here's what's usually driving the spread.

  • Different inventory assumptions

    One provider weighs by visual survey, another estimates from your description. Same load, different cubic feet.

  • Route density & backhaul

    A provider running your lane this week prices very differently than one that has to deadhead a truck.

  • Date flexibility

    Flexible windows let providers consolidate loads — guaranteed dates cost more across the board.

  • Service scope creep

    Full packing, long carry, shuttle service, stairs, and storage-in-transit all add line items.

  • Estimate type

    Non-binding lowball quotes get re-weighed. Binding-not-to-exceed caps the upside.

  • Red flags

    Unusually low quotes, large up-front deposits, and missing USDOT numbers are signals — not bargains.

How far in advance should I book a move from Albuquerque?

4–8 weeks ahead during peak summer and month-end. 2–3 weeks is usually workable off-peak. Partial-load and consolidated shipments can fit shorter timelines.
